Madeira Airport (Cristiano Ronaldo International Airport), located in Portugal, is often considered a challenging airport for aviation due to several factors:

  • Short Runway:

    Initially, the runway was quite short, making landings and takeoffs difficult, requiring precision and skill from pilots. While the runway has been extended, it still presents challenges.

  • Mountainous Terrain:

    The airport is surrounded by steep mountains and the ocean. This geography requires pilots to execute complex maneuvers during approach and departure to avoid obstacles.

  • Strong and Unpredictable Winds:

    The location is prone to strong and turbulent winds, which can change rapidly and significantly affect aircraft handling, making approaches and landings particularly challenging.

  • "Approach over the Ocean":

    The approach to the runway often involves flying over the ocean, which can be visually disorienting and requires precise altitude control.

  • Runway Construction:

    A significant portion of the runway is built on a platform extending over the ocean, supported by concrete pillars. This unique structure requires careful consideration during landings and takeoffs.

These combined factors demand specialized training and certification for pilots to operate at Madeira Airport, making it known as one of the more challenging airports in the world.
